首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何手机预览本地环境下的域名

基础概念

手机预览本地环境下的域名通常涉及到将本地服务器的域名解析到手机上,以便能够在手机上访问本地开发环境。这通常用于移动端应用的开发和测试。

相关优势

  1. 便捷性:可以在手机上直接预览和测试应用,无需通过电脑或其他设备。
  2. 真实环境模拟:更接近实际使用场景,有助于发现和解决移动端特有的问题。
  3. 跨平台测试:支持多种手机操作系统(如iOS和Android),确保应用在不同平台上的兼容性。

类型

  1. 本地DNS解析:通过修改本地DNS设置,将域名指向本地IP地址。
  2. 动态DNS服务:使用第三方服务动态更新DNS记录,将域名指向本地IP地址。
  3. 局域网内访问:通过局域网内的IP地址直接访问本地服务器。

应用场景

  • 移动应用开发:在手机上预览和测试Web应用或移动应用。
  • 网站开发:在手机上预览和测试网站,确保响应式设计的效果。
  • API测试:在手机上测试本地服务器提供的API接口。

解决问题的步骤

1. 本地DNS解析

步骤

  1. 找到本地IP地址
  2. 找到本地IP地址
  3. 修改本地DNS设置
    • Windows
      1. 打开“控制面板” -> “网络和共享中心” -> “更改适配器设置”。
      2. 右键点击正在使用的网络连接 -> “属性”。
      3. 选择“Internet协议版本4 (TCP/IPv4)” -> “属性”。
      4. 选择“使用下面的DNS服务器地址”,输入本地IP地址(如192.168.1.1)。
    1. macOS
      1. 打开“系统偏好设置” -> “网络”。
      2. 选择正在使用的网络连接 -> “高级” -> “DNS”。
      3. 点击“+”号,输入本地IP地址。
  4. 配置hosts文件
    • Windows
      1. 打开“C:\Windows\System32\drivers\etc\hosts”文件(需要管理员权限)。
      2. 添加一行:
      3. 添加一行:
    1. macOS/Linux
      1. 打开“/etc/hosts”文件(需要管理员权限)。
      2. 添加一行:
      3. 添加一行:

2. 动态DNS服务

步骤

  1. 注册并配置动态DNS服务
    • 选择一个第三方动态DNS服务提供商(如No-IP、DynDNS等),注册并获取API密钥。
    • 在服务提供商的管理界面中,添加一个域名并配置动态DNS更新。
  • 安装并配置DDClient
    • 下载并安装DDClient(适用于Windows、macOS、Linux)。
    • 配置DDClient,指定动态DNS服务提供商的API密钥和域名。

3. 局域网内访问

步骤

  1. 找到本地IP地址
  2. 找到本地IP地址
  3. 在手机上访问本地IP地址
    • 打开手机浏览器,输入本地IP地址(如192.168.1.1)。

常见问题及解决方法

问题:手机无法访问本地域名

原因

  1. DNS解析失败:可能是hosts文件配置错误或DNS服务器设置不正确。
  2. 防火墙阻止:本地防火墙可能阻止了外部设备访问本地服务器。
  3. 网络连接问题:手机和电脑不在同一个局域网内。

解决方法

  1. 检查hosts文件和DNS设置
    • 确保hosts文件配置正确,DNS服务器设置正确。
  • 关闭防火墙
    • 临时关闭本地防火墙,测试是否能访问。
  • 检查网络连接
    • 确保手机和电脑在同一个局域网内,可以通过ping命令测试连接。

示例代码

假设本地服务器运行在192.168.1.1,端口为3000,可以通过以下方式访问:

代码语言:txt
复制
<!-- 在手机浏览器中输入 -->
http://192.168.1.1:3000

或者通过配置hosts文件后访问:

代码语言:txt
复制
<!-- 在手机浏览器中输入 -->
http://example.local:3000

参考链接

希望这些信息对你有所帮助!如果有更多问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

百万域名情况如何快速获取域名 IP 列表

在我们针对某个目标进行信息收集时,获取二级域名可能是我们最重要环节,公司越大,使用多级域名越多,收集到域名之后,想要做端口扫描话,直接针对域名做扫描吗?...当然不是,因为同一个 IP 可能被配置了多个域名,直接针对域名做端口扫描也不是不可以,就是会做很多重复工作,所以要先将这些域名解析成 IP 地址,然后进行去重,这样能够大大节约端口扫描时间。.../projectdiscovery/dnsx 该项目由 go 语言编写,首先你需要安装好 go 编译环境,然后安装很简单: go get -v github.com/projectdiscovery/...-u > ips.txt 会写脚本情况,这个目标很容易实现,不会写也没关系,会用开源免费工具一样可以达到效果。...最近几天信安之路在进行公益SRC漏洞挖掘实战训练计划,引导学员进行实战演练,零基础会用工具情况就可以挖到漏洞,这是本次训练计划目标,通过此次训练之后,可以独立完成针对目标的通用测试,首先成为一名脚本小子

4.5K20
  • 本地环境启动openFaas创建Java云函数

    一、创建一个JAVA工程 二、在该目录下创建一个javaopenfaas云函数 现在目录如下: 三、创建entrypoint子模块 由于云函数本地运行需要main函数,为了与云函数解耦,我们用子模块来实现...创建后目录如下: 四、修改主工程settings.gradle,添加云函数关联 点击同步(十分重要) 此时云函数就会以子模块方式存在在项目里 五、给entryPoint添加云函数依赖...首先在子模块配置里进行修改: 这里有几个关键点,首先要在entrypoint模块添加依赖,其次要在entrypointmain文件夹下添加以来,最后是添加是java-fn main这个依赖...(这里是坑最深地方) 然后在build.grade里面进行修改 这里要注意添加是子模块名,不是project名称 七、点击同步: 八、验证 在enrtypoint里面创建main函数,可以看到调用

    46210

    本地环境启动openFaas创建Java云函数

    一、创建一个JAVA工程图片图片二、在该目录下创建一个javaopenfaas云函数图片现在目录如下:图片三、创建entrypoint子模块由于云函数本地运行需要main函数,为了与云函数解耦,我们用子模块来实现图片创建后目录如下...:图片四、修改主工程settings.gradle,添加云函数关联图片点击同步(十分重要)图片此时云函数就会以子模块方式存在在项目里图片五、给entryPoint添加云函数依赖首先在子模块配置里进行修改...:图片图片这里有几个关键点,首先要在entrypoint模块添加依赖,其次要在entrypointmain文件夹下添加以来,最后是添加是java-fn main这个依赖(这里是坑最深地方)图片然后在...build.grade里面进行修改图片这里要注意添加是子模块名,不是project名称七、点击同步:图片八、验证在enrtypoint里面创建main函数,可以看到调用Handler成功图片

    1.6K70

    如何使用XAMPP搭建本地环境WordPress网站

    如何使用XAMPP搭建本地环境WordPress网站 文章目录[隐藏] 为什么要搭建本地WordPress网站? 什么是XAMMP?...在计算机上安装XAMPP 使用XAMPP搭建建本地WordPress网站 搭建本地环境WordPress网站后 如何使用XAMPP搭建本地环境WordPress网站 想学习WordPress建站,不想买服务器...在本文中,晓得博客将向您展示如何使用XAMPP轻松创建本地环境WordPress网站。 为什么要搭建本地WordPress网站?   ...重要提示:只有您在计算机上才能看到本地网站。如果您想制作一个实时网站,则需要一个域名和WordPress托管。 什么是XAMMP?   ...5/5 (1 Review) 晓得博客 » (2020)如何使用XAMPP搭建本地环境WordPress网站 转载请保留链接:https://www.pythonthree.com/how-to-create-a-local-wordpress-site-using-xampp

    3.8K20

    如何在Xcode预览含有Core Data元素SwiftUI视图

    如何在Xcode预览含有Core Data元素SwiftUI视图 从SwiftUI诞生之日起,预览(Canvas Preview )一直是个让开发者又爱又恨功能。...结合两年来我在SwiftUI中使用Core Data经验和教训,我们将在本文中探讨: •导致SwiftUI预览崩溃部分原因•如何在之后开发中避免类似的崩溃出现•如何在Xcode中安全可靠地预览含有...•在模拟器设备管理器中删除模拟器再重新添加 上述手段,多数也都适用于修复某些情况预览崩溃。...常见Core Data元素视图预览故障 在应用程序可以正常执行情况,真正由于Core Data因素导致预览崩溃原因其实并不多。...预置复杂数据Bundle数据库 对于拥有复杂数据模型应用该如何创建用于预览演示数据呢?

    5.1K10

    前后端分离状态如何搭建微信公众号网页本地开发环境

    需求分析 进行微信公众号网页开发时候,微信平台一般有如下几个要求: 必须是https协议 通过验证可信域名 开发过程中一般有如下几个需求: 本地开发,正常调用微信API,实时调试。...和正常浏览器一样开发体验。 开发环境配置 1.基础设置 构建工具都自带了web服务器,但是对于配置https以及自定义域名不是很友好。...proxy_pass http://192.168.2.3:8081; } 将指定域名解析到局域网IP或者127.0.0.1,然后绑定到本地Nginx站点,这样就可以通过Nginx绑定指定域名访问开发服务器了...然后把这个域名添加到微信公众号可信域名,同时在Nginx配置好https。 此时已经可以在微信开发者工具内,正常访问开发环境,并调用微信js Api。...3.手机端访问 将手机(wifi)和用于开发电脑连接到同一个局域网,将指定域名解析到你本地局域网IP,一切准备妥当之后,可以直接在手机微信端访问本地开发环境服务器地址。

    63140

    安卓手机平板远程访问本地Linux环境code-server写代码

    前言 本文主要介绍如何在Linux Ubuntu系统安装code-server,并结合cpolar内网穿透工具配置公网地址,轻松实现使用安卓手机、平板等设备远程使用vscode开发写代码。...code-server登录密码 export PASSWORD=”000000” 查看IP地址,作局域网访问使用 code-server服务默认为8080端口号, 为了防止8080端口冲突,我们修改一...协议:http 本地地址:8077 端口类型:随机域名 地区:China vip 点击创建 创建成功后我们打开在线隧道列表,可以看到刚刚创建成功隧道,已经有生成了相应公网地址,把公网地址复制下来,...打开安卓浏览器输入上面的固定http链接即可访问成功 6.结语 在安卓使用vscode主要是连接一个远程code-server服务,code-server服务安装在什么系统,调用就是什么系统环境,...如这里使用Ubuntu进行安装code-server,那使用就是Ubuntu环境,如需要go,python,java开发,需要在Ubuntu安装相关环境,创建文件夹和项目也是在Ubuntu里面.这种方式其实在访问

    18320

    何时以及如何在你本地开发环境中使用 HTTPS

    但是在某些情况,你需要使用 HTTPS 在本地运行站点。 所以本文将针对 2 个问题展开: 何时需要在本地开发环境中使用 HTTPS? 如何本地开发环境中使用 HTTPS?...何时需要在本地开发环境中使用 HTTPS 在本地开发时,默认情况使用 http://localhost。Service Workers, Web 认证 API, 以及一些别的等都可以工作。...在这种情况,即使 Chrome,Edge,Safari 和 Firefox 是本地站点,默认情况也不认为 mysite.example 是安全。因此,它行为不会像 HTTPS 站点那样。...何时使用 HTTPS 进行本地开发 如何本地开发环境中使用 HTTPS 你可能会遇到一些特殊情况,比如 http://localhost 网站行为不像 HTTPS 网站,或者你可能只是想使用一个不是...这意味着你不能够使用实际证书颁发机构: localhost 以及其他保留域名,比如 example 或者 test; 任何你不能控制域名; 无效顶级域名 反向代理 使用 HTTPS 访问本地运行站点另一个选择是使用反向代理

    2.6K30

    如何建立云环境性能测试策略

    环境性能测试 在云环境测试与非云环境测试类似。它涉及到一系列测试,帮助团队来分析系统各个方面,包括各种不同云应用场景--公有云、私有云或混合云。...性能测试在不同场景内得出对软件或应用程序测试结果。 不同之处在于,在云环境设置,性能测试规划和执行不太适用。最重要是,在云环境响应时间可以不同于在非云环境时间。...因此,建议在高负载环境运行性能测试时,评估响应时间。 这些测试需要定期运行以记录最小、最大和平均响应时间。这将有助于在实际测试过程中,跟踪应用程序响应时间。...在云模型中,模型或多或少是按需付费,弹性测试有助于验证所使用服务,并根据使用情况估算成本。这种方法可以在高负荷穿过断点,可以增加和减少负荷。...在构建策略时需要考虑各种因素--项目环境、业务驱动因素、接受因素、技术堆栈、可用技能集、资源和方法。 在云环境设置,测试环境将被监测和推进,从而针对应用程序进行有效测试。

    1.6K100

    在Windows如何创建指定虚拟环境

    前几天给大家分享了如何在默认情况创建虚拟环境,没来得及上车伙伴,可以戳这篇文章:在Windows如何创建虚拟环境(默认情况)。今天小编给大家分享一如何创建指定Python环境。...小编电脑上默认Python解释器是Python3版本,那么现在想要创建一个Python2版本虚拟环境,具体方法如下。...其中-p意思是指定Python版本,后面跟着是Python对应版本安装路径,记得将python.exe带上。最后demo是虚拟环境名字。 ?...可以看到demo已经在路径最前面,而且有括号括住,说明虚拟环境已经激活了。 6、此时输入在Python虚拟环境中输入python,如下图所示,可以看到Python版本是Python2。 ?...此时,demo文件夹已经不见了,括号也消失了,说明成功退出了虚拟环境。 8、此时如果再在命令行中新建虚拟环境的话,则默认是Python3虚拟环境,再次就不再赘述。

    73110

    Linux环境Apache服务器配置二级域名方法详解

    本文实例讲述了Linux环境Apache服务器配置二级域名方法。...分享给大家供大家参考,具体如下: (以域名www.csdn.net为例,现在需要配置一个二级域名blog.csdn.net指向主机地址) 首先,确认开启Apache配置文件httpd.conf中mod_rewrite...这里科普一这个模块: ? 接下来我们需要登录所购域名运营商域名管理后台,点击‘域名解析’: ?...手动添加或一键快速添加下面两条默认解析,形如www.csdn.net和csdn.net域名就可以访问主机地址了 ? 添加一条需要配置二级域名解析: ?...然后在Apache配置文件httpd.conf末尾 添加如下域名配置: ServerAdmin msllws@163.com DocumentRoot /

    2.5K41

    在Windows如何创建指定虚拟环境

    前几天给大家分享了如何在默认情况创建虚拟环境,没来得及上车伙伴,可以戳这篇文章:在Windows如何创建虚拟环境(默认情况)。今天小编给大家分享一如何创建指定Python环境。...小编电脑上默认Python解释器是Python3版本,那么现在想要创建一个Python2版本虚拟环境,具体方法如下。...其中-p意思是指定Python版本,后面跟着是Python对应版本安装路径,记得将python.exe带上。最后demo是虚拟环境名字。 ?...可以看到demo已经在路径最前面,而且有括号括住,说明虚拟环境已经激活了。 6、此时输入在Python虚拟环境中输入python,如下图所示,可以看到Python版本是Python2。 ?...以后我们如果想创建虚拟环境的话,就可以自由进行切换了。

    66110

    如何在LinuxApache环境部署SSL证书

    随着HTTPS火热,越来越多小伙伴愿意去配置SSL证书(毕竟全浏览器绿标哦),上次发布了如何在IIS环境配置SSL后,部分小伙伴留言说需要阿帕奇教程,今天我们就为大家更新哈。...(上次也说了,HTTPS有什么样好处,大家不会不知道吧) 下面看看如何在apache环境安装吧。...如何在CentOS配置ApacheHTTPS服务,这里以自签证书(仅用于测试)为例:如果CentOS已经安装了Apache Web服务器,我们需要使用OpenSSL生成自签名证书。...和https是两个站点,这样情况我们需要对http进行跳转(和iis重写一个道理),强制跳转到https页面才有绿标啊。...所有的这些前提是你有有自己SSL证书(腾讯云免费申请ssl证书),免费也好,付费也罢,总之你需要有,如何获取免费SSL证书,请查看小编历史文章即可。

    2.2K50

    如何使用Java代码访问Kerberos环境Kudu

    温馨提示:如果使用电脑查看图片不清晰,可以使用手机打开文章单击文中图片放大查看高清原图。...访问CDHKudu》,文章是在非安全环境实现,随着对集群安全要求提高,在Kerberos环境使用API访问Kudu也会有一些变化,本篇文章Fayson主要介绍如何使用Java代码访问Kerberos...环境Kudu。...5 总结 1.在进行本地开发时,必须将集群hostname及IP配置在本地hosts文件中(如果使用DNS服务则可以不配置hosts文件),否则无法与集群互通,确保本地客户端与集群端口是放通。...2.访问Kerberos环境Kudu时,需要使用HDFS API提供UserGroupInformation类实现Kerberos账号登录认证,该API在登录Kerberos认证后,会启动一个线程定时刷新认证

    2.9K31

    利用微搭搭建信息查询小程序

    、创建应用、创建页面、实现功能、预览发布、配置域名等几个步骤。...还有需要注意是平台在做数据导入时候会导两份,一份导入预览环境里,一份导入到正式环境里。 创建应用 我们是两个诉求,一个是PC端管理后台需求,一个是小程序。我们先创建一个PC端应用。...点击控制台,点击应用,从excel创建应用 [在这里插入图片描述] 然后选中从本地上传 [在这里插入图片描述] 从本地选择好你excel [在这里插入图片描述] 系统会自动获取excel中列,并且按照类型进行识别...,一般有两个选择,发布成h5或者小程序,看自己需要,如果需要手机用户信息就发布成小程序,如果只是当网站使用就发布成h5即可 域名绑定 微搭自带了域名,比较长可能使用起来不太方便,这个时候就需要绑定一自己域名...在导航条找到云产品,找到云开发cloudbase [在这里插入图片描述] 找到自己环境 [在这里插入图片描述] 在静态网站托管里点击详细配置 [在这里插入图片描述] 然后添加自己域名即可 [在这里插入图片描述

    3.5K40
    领券